Preferred Label : Transverse Head of Adductor Hallucis Muscle;
NCIt related terms : ADDUCTOR HALLUCIS MUSCLE, TRANSVERSE HEAD;
NCIt definition : The smaller of two heads of the adductor hallucis muscle. It originates from the deep
transverse metatarsal ligament and the plantar surface of the metatarsophalangeal
joints of the lateral three toes.;
